Teamspeak 3 -- Best Audio Codec

themctipers

I want the highest voice/music quality for a Teamspeak 3 server. 

Which codec is it?

Speex Ultra-Wideband

CELT Mono

Opus Voice

Opus Music

i've always used speex on teamspeak, and it made my pothead voice (thats a very deep voice) friend's blue yeti sound absolutely gorgeous on my end.

never in my life have i thought it to be possible to play minecraft with morgan freeman.

 

speex also seems to be very forgiving when connections are shyte, or when you have to put people at +6.5 because they cant properly set up a mic.

Opus music seems to be the best for me, but if someone has a really bad connection or bad mic, it DEFINITELY sounds way worse on music preset.
